Werder Bremen defender Felix Agu is set for another spell on the sidelines.
Agu recently returned to action for the Greens after spending around four months on the sidelines due to a syndesmosis ligament injury.
The injury also forced the left-back to miss the 2025 Africa Cup of Nations in Morocco.
The Nigeria international injured himself during warm-up ahead of Bremen’s Bundesliga clash with St. Pauli last weekend.
Bremen confirmed he suffered a muscle injury in his adductor area, and will be sidelined for the time being.
The 26-year-old has made nine league appearances for the Greens this season.
